
A Green Bay man, who was already facing charges in a child sex case, is now also facing additional charges after he allegedly attempted to hire a hitman.
Laene Piontek was arrested on the child sex charges on June 14th, and while in the Brown County Jail, asked his cellmate to kill a couple of witnesses in his case.
Piontek told the unnamed man that he would pay him a total of $20,000 to do the job, and provided him with a map to the home of the witnesses and a detailed description of them.
Piontek is now being held on an additional $100,000 cash bond, on top of the $50,000cash bond in his first case.
He is facing, in total, two felony counts of Solicitation of First Degree Intentional Homicide, 1st Degree Sexual Assault of a Child Under Age 12 and Repeated Acts of Sexual Assault of a Child.
